Even though Oklahoma voters only legalized medical marijuana in June 2018, the state has become one of the fastest-growing state-legal cannabis industries in the country. With a sea of dispensaries in Oklahoma, the Vertica dispensary brand has set itself apart in a few important ways.

What makes us different at the farm is our desire to put care for Mother Earth and our patients first and foremost. Every nutrient we use in our feeding program is organic. We don’t say we are organic just because we grow in coco or dirt (like many folks will claim).

We use only organic nutrients in our fertilizer mixes; we clean our facility with OMRI listed cleaners; all of our drip irrigation lines are cleaned out using OMRI listed products as well.

In addition to opting exclusively for organic nutrients, our nutrients are powder-based. Liquid nutrients are mostly water and cost more money and fossil fuels to ship to and from, whereas the powder-based nutrients have a smaller carbon footprint.

Being in a greenhouse, we are able to drastically reduce our carbon footprint as we only need to use grow lights when the sun is insufficient. As opposed to indoor grows, which use artificial lighting for 12 hours every day in flower and 18-24 hours every day in vegetative mode, we will only use lighting when needed.

We have also installed a control system that calculates the incoming solar radiation so we know exactly how much light our plants have received on any given day. So, if it was sunny out all day, and our plants receive all the light they can use, our system will not turn on the lights even if the timeframe for that light was less than 12 hours.

Most grows, even greenhouse grows, will make sure that their plants get 12 hours of light in flowering, if the sun provided enough light in 10 hours that day, there is no need to add another 2 hours of artificial lighting. Vertica is equipped to implement the energy and carbon savings.

We have also installed a state-of-the-art irrigation system which is capable of watering only when the plants (or microbes, in our case) need more water. We do not need to over water our plants just to make sure they are wet, we know exactly how much water is in our plants and are able to derive water savings, and therefore fertilizer savings, as a result.

Everything we do at the farm we do with the intention of minimizing our impact on the world around us and maximizing the medical efficacy of our product.

What do you think of the local cannabis industry?

What is happening in the Oklahoma Cannabis industry is a true testament to what local business and local entrepreneurship can do to an economy. From the local real estate boom to all of the thousands of jobs created, it’s the most exciting thing to happen to Oklahoma in a very long time. Not to mention the most important thing, that people can now treat their illnesses with the plant instead of pills and thousands of people are finding relief from pain through the use of cannabis.
